Harris still got a few good years left in him. Siddle's possible return to the top side could be a question of how serious his stress fractures are and how they heal. Dennis Lillee was one who successfully made a return from them, but he had to remodel his whole action. And he was one of the lucky ones.
 
If Siddle can't bowl at 150km/h like we know he can then he'll struggle to reach the expectations that we have. He was ineffective bowling around 140km/h and was easy meat for the batters.
 
I used to think Hauritz was terrible and going with all pace would be the way to go. But you have to respect the guy, his figures are great and a lot of them were compiled in unfavorable conditions. He will always be the guy where the selectors will be on the lookout for something better, but it seems they've finally realized there aren't any upgrades in Australia at this point.
